When does theta decay happen?
Theta decays every day, including weekends (though options don't trade). The decay is priced in gradually. Some traders see accelerated Friday decay as markets price in the weekend.
How do I profit from theta?
Sell options to collect theta. Covered calls, cash-secured puts, credit spreads, and iron condors all benefit from time decay. The key is having the underlying stay within your profitable range while time passes.
Why does theta accelerate near expiration?
Options have less time for big moves to happen, so time premium evaporates quickly. The uncertainty (and thus time value) drops rapidly as expiration approaches and the probable range of outcomes narrows.
